Subway Stabbing And The Police Response
- Joseph "Joe" Lazito was stabbed multiple times on a NYC subway while two officers hid in the motorman's compartment.
- He later learned officers admitted they stayed back because they thought the attacker might have a gun and he sued the NYPD but lost.
Castle Rock Tragedy And Lawsuit
- Jessica Lanahan's three daughters were taken and later found murdered after police repeatedly ignored her calls about a restraining order violation.
- She sued Castle Rock police claiming due process violations and ultimately lost at the U.S. Supreme Court.
Constitution Protects From State, Not For Protection
- The U.S. Constitution creates protections against the state but does not impose an affirmative duty on police to protect individuals.
- Courts have repeatedly held that the Constitution doesn't require police to protect citizens from private harms.
